Emma Hayes plans a "whole new lineup" for the Chile match, providing opportunities for inexperienced players.
Trinity Rodman, the highest-paid player in women's soccer, will not start, as Hayes manages player loads during the preseason.
Three players – Reilyn Turner, Maddie Dahlien, and Sally Menti – earned their first caps in the previous game against Paraguay.
The match against Chile is the USWNT's first full international match at Harder Stadium in Santa Barbara.
This camp is a testing ground to identify players for the 2027 World Cup, the 2028 Olympics and beyond.
The USWNT is using this friendly against Chile to evaluate and integrate new and young players into the squad. Coach Emma Hayes is focused on building a strong tactical foundation ahead of the Concacaf W Championship in November, which serves as the World Cup qualification tournament. The game allows Hayes to assess player compatibility and tactical adaptability. This approach ensures that the USWNT is well-prepared for upcoming challenges, including the SheBelieves Cup and future World Cup qualifiers. The emphasis on development and experimentation aims to create a versatile and competitive team for the long term.
